Abstract
The situation of producing metallo-β-1 actamases and the genotypes in imipenem-resistant P.aeruginosaisolate in hospital were investigated in this study.Antimicrobial susceptibility testing of 16 kinds of antibiotics was conducted with Kirby-Bauer method.And EDTA disc was used to screen metallo-β-lactamase-producing strains from imipenem-resistant P.aeruginosa.Metallo-β-lactamase genes were amplified by PCR and then sequenced.In our experiment,4 metallo-β-lactamase producing strains were screened from 53 strains of carbapenem resistance P.aeruginosaby EDTA disc synergy test.And 3 of 4 strains were confirmed by PCR,and DNA sequencing indicated that they were VIM-2 gene-type.These results showed that the VIM-2 isoform of metallo-β-lactamase in P.aeruginosa was becoming the prevalent and most clinically significant determinants of carbapenem resistance in our hospital.Therefore,it should be paid more attention to the epidemiology and therapeutic management.The antibiotics should be used rationally according to the antibiotic resistance.
